Merge pull request #1498 from atom/ks-rename-select-list

Rename SelectList to SelectListView
This commit is contained in:
Kevin Sawicki
2014-01-31 15:00:08 -08:00
4 changed files with 12 additions and 8 deletions

View File

@@ -30,7 +30,7 @@ The classes available from `require 'atom'` are:
* [Point][Point]
* [Range][Range]
* [ScrollView][ScrollView]
* [SelectList][SelectList]
* [SelectListView][SelectListView]
* [View][View]
* [WorkspaceView][WorkspaceView]
@@ -55,7 +55,7 @@ Atom ships with node 0.11.10 and the comprehensive node API docs are available
[Point]: ../classes/Point.html
[Range]: ../classes/Range.html
[ScrollView]: ../classes/ScrollView.html
[SelectList]: ../classes/SelectList.html
[SelectListView]: ../classes/SelectListView.html
[View]: ../classes/View.html
[WorkspaceView]: ../classes/WorkspaceView.html
[creating-a-package]: https://www.atom.io/docs/latest/creating-a-package

View File

@@ -22,7 +22,11 @@ unless process.env.ATOM_SHELL_INTERNAL_RUN_AS_NODE
module.exports.$$$ = $$$
module.exports.EditorView = require '../src/editor-view'
module.exports.WorkspaceView = require '../src/workspace-view'
module.exports.SelectList = require '../src/select-list'
# TODO Remove once packages have been updated
module.exports.SelectList = require '../src/select-list-view'
module.exports.SelectListView = require '../src/select-list-view'
module.exports.ScrollView = require '../src/scroll-view'
module.exports.Task = require '../src/task'
module.exports.View = View

View File

@@ -1,7 +1,7 @@
SelectList = require '../src/select-list'
SelectListView = require '../src/select-list-view'
{$, $$} = require 'atom'
describe "SelectList", ->
describe "SelectListView", ->
[selectList, array, list, miniEditor] = []
beforeEach ->
@@ -10,7 +10,7 @@ describe "SelectList", ->
["D", "Delta"], ["E", "Echo"], ["F", "Foxtrot"]
]
selectList = new SelectList
selectList = new SelectListView
selectList.maxItems = 4
selectList.filterKey = 1
selectList.itemForElement = (element) ->

View File

@@ -8,10 +8,10 @@ fuzzyFilter = require('fuzzaldrin').filter
# ## Requiring in packages
#
# ```coffee
# {SelectList} = require 'atom'
# {SelectListView} = require 'atom'
# ```
module.exports =
class SelectList extends View
class SelectListView extends View
# Private:
@content: ->